Convert a CSV spreadsheet of contacts into a vCard (.vcf) file that can be imported by iPhone, Android, Outlook, Gmail, and most contact management apps. All conversion happens in your browser — no data is sent to any server, keeping your contact list completely private.
No. CSV to vCard conversion runs entirely in your browser. Your contacts never leave your device.
Your CSV should include at minimum Name, Phone, and Email columns. Additional columns like Company, Address, and Title are also typically supported.
The .vcf output is compatible with iPhone Contacts, Android Contacts, Outlook, Gmail, Mac Contacts, and virtually any contact app that supports the vCard standard.
Yes. The tool handles bulk contact lists — all contacts from the CSV are included in a single .vcf file that you import once to add all contacts.
CSV files up to 5 MB are supported, which is sufficient for thousands of contacts.
